Quote from AutoFixerMike on June 17, 2025, 2:47 pmLately, I noticed that my car engine vibrates noticeably when it's idling, especially when waiting at traffic lights. The shaking seems to get worse when the AC is on. The car drives fine otherwise, but the shaking at idle is really annoying. I'm not sure if it's something serious like engine mounts or just dirty fuel injectors. Has anyone faced this issue before? What should I check first to diagnose the problem?

Quote from CheckEngineChamp on June 17, 2025, 2:48 pmIt could be several things, but most commonly engine shaking at idle is caused by bad motor mounts, dirty fuel injectors, or worn spark plugs. I had a similar issue with my Honda Civic, and replacing the spark plugs and cleaning the injectors fixed it. You might want to scan for any engine codes as well — sometimes a misfire code (like P0300) can point you in the right direction.
